#AC140C Hex Color Code

#AC140C

The Hexadecimal Color #AC140C is a contrast shade of Fire Brick. #AC140C RGB value is rgb(172, 20, 12). RGB Color Model of #AC140C consists of 67% red, 7% green and 4% blue. HSL color Mode of #AC140C has 3°(degrees) Hue, 87% Saturation and 36% Lightness. #AC140C color has an wavelength of 618.11111n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#AC140C is #CC3333.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#AC140C is #A11. The Closest Color to #AC140C is #B22222. Official Name of #AC140C Hex Code is Milano Red.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#AC140C is 0 Cyan 88 Magenta 93 Yellow 33 Black and #AC140C CMY is 0, 88, 93.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#AC140C is hsl(3,87,36,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(3, 93, 67).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#AC140C is 17.33, 9.3, 1.23.
Hex8 Value of #AC140C is #AC140CFF. Decimal Value of #AC140C is 11277324 and Octal Value of #AC140C is 53012014. Binary Value of #AC140C is 10101100, 10100, 1100 and Android of #AC140C is 4289467404 / 0xffac140c.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#AC140C is 0.622, 0.334, 0.334 and YIQ Color Space of #AC140C is 64.536, 93.1472, 29.6584.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#AC140C is 16.49, 3.6, 1.39.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#AC140C is 36.56, 56.99, 45.74.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#AC140C is 36.56, 111.21, 25.22.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#AC140C is 36.56, 73.08, 38.75. Hunter Lab variable of #AC140C is 30.5, 48.07, 18.96.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#AC140C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
